Locke Cambridge Turing Star rating not available

47 Eddington Avenue, Cambridge Central North West, CB3 1SE

facilities

  • 24hr Reception
  • Gym
  • Parking
  • Restaurant
  • Bar

back to event details

venue map

venue address

47 Eddington Avenue
Eddington
Cambridge Central North West
Cambridgeshire
CB3 1SE

more information